NFRC rating system and labeling system for energy performance windows and doors, skylights and attachment products

The National Fenestration Rating Council is an organization for non-profits that provides an uniform and independent labeling system that evaluates the energy performance of windows and doors, skylights, and other products for attachment. This label aids consumers in making an informed decision about products that are energy efficient.

These energy ratings are in addition to other NFRC labels , such as air quality and structural performance ratings. These ratings are useful in determining the energy efficiency of the building.

A window is graded in accordance with the U-factor and the R-value. The U-factor represents the product's insulative value while the R-value represents the insulation value of other components in the building envelope.

Some energy ratings are based on computer simulations, while others are based on actual measurements of solar heat gains. Either way, you can determine the appropriateness of a product for your home.

While the majority of window ratings are based on the same parameters, they may vary from one region to another. This is because of the necessity to be able to adapt to the latest technologies.

Apart from determining the insulation value of the window, ratings also assess the performance of the sealants, weatherstripping and insulating glass units. They also measure the transmittance of light in the visible spectrum.

NFRC labels can be found in many areas and provide more details than the R-value and the U-factor. They provide ratings for Solar Heat Gain Coefficient Visible Light Transmittance and Air Leakage Condensation Resistance, and more.

Certified products by the NFRC are independently tested and certified by a third-party. The certification process includes an independent assessment of the product's design and manufacture, and participation in the NFRC rating and labeling system.

Many companies in the fenestration industry are members of the NFRC. This organization was created in response to the 1970s energy crisis. Today, NFRC includes government agencies as well as researchers, manufacturers and manufacturers as well as suppliers. Its ratings are utilized in all major energy efficiency programs.
